Smino – Lemon Pon Goose w/ Jean Deaux (Prod By Sango)

Oh yeah, this song is freakin’ awesome, as it doesn’t follow typical recipes and combines dancehall, r&b and hip hop aesthetics. Produced by Soulections own Sango and garnished with vocals by Smino and Mrs. Jean Deaux. Fiyah!
